The world of adults is incomprehensible to a small child. Adults do so much! There are police officers, engineers, pilots, doctors, and thousands of other professions. But children are interested in only one thing – play. During the games, they not only have fun, but also learn.

Play-based learning is an approach that uses play as a natural way for children to explore, learn, and develop. He acknowledges that young children learn best when they are actively engaged and entertained.

Traditional teaching methods often rely on rote memorization. Play-based learning emphasizes exploration, creativity, and hands-on experience. It is more fun and effective for young children as it matches their natural curiosity and developmental needs.

At the heart of this game-based learning is science. For example, research in developmental psychology and neuroscience shows that play is essential for children's cognitive, social, emotional, and physical development. The game stimulates the growth of neural connections in the brain, promoting problem-solving, creativity and self-control. This is facilitated by open-type toys that children can explore at their own pace.

 

Key Principles of Game-Based Learning

To effectively support game-based learning, keep the following key principles in mind:

Under the guidance of the child. Follow your child's interests and allow them to take the lead in their learning journey.

An open-ended type of game. Give children the opportunity to explore and experiment without a predetermined outcome.

Process-oriented. Focus on the learning process, not on specific outcomes.

Safe and supportive environment. The safer your child feels, the more risk they are willing to take. Of course, a safe physical environment is important, but a reliable connection with parents is also important. The more positive and open-minded the parent is, the more confident the child feels.

 

Best Games for Game-Based Learning

Wooden Cubes

Role play: toy kitchen, supermarket checkout, dollhouses or wooden railroad

Crafts

Puzzles & Board Games

Sensory Toys: Plasticine, Kinetic Sand and Sensory Boxes Filled with Various Materials

Outdoor play toys: tricycles, jump ropes, balls and crayons

Musical Instruments

When choosing playful learning toys, focus on those that offer multiple ways to play, encourage creativity and critical thinking, and promote active participation rather than passive entertainment.
